Motorcycle Accident Compensation

Receiving compensation for your motorcycle accident following your crash is an important step in the road to recovery. You should not accept an offer from an insurance firm without consulting with an experienced personal injury lawyer to ensure you receive the money you deserve for your injuries.

A knowledgeable motorcycle accident lawyer can assess all your damages and create a case that can prove you are entitled to an equitable settlement. This includes medical bills and lost earnings as well as discomfort and pain.

Pain and suffering

A motorcycle crash can result in serious health and financial problems. It is possible that they will lose the ability to drive a motorcycle and have to pay for lost income or medical bills.

Fortunately, there is an option for those who have been injured in a motorbike crash that is compensation for injuries sustained in a motorcycle accident. This form of compensation for injury can help cover expenses like hospital visits, physical therapy and prescriptions. In addition, it can also include emotional pain and suffering associated with the accident as well as your injuries.

This type of compensation is particularly beneficial to those who have suffered serious injuries like traumatic brain injuries and broken bones. These kinds of injuries are difficult to treat and require long-term care.

The nature of your injury will determine the amount of pain and suffering compensation you receive. Insurance companies generally use a formula that considers the seriousness and longevity of your injuries. This means that you are more likely to receive a higher amount for a brain injury than if it was just a bruised your leg.

Insurance companies also consider the loss of earning potential. They will determine how much your wages are affected by the accident and how it impacts your daily life. This is a substantial loss that should be considered in any settlement negotiations in the event that you are in a position to work because of your injury.

Furthermore, you should take into consideration whether your accident has caused any existing medical conditions. This can help you determine whether the accident led to an increase in your pain and suffering.
